哈喽,大家好呀,欢迎走进体检知音的网站,说实在的啊现在体检也越来越重要,不少的朋友也因为体检不合格导致了和心仪的工作失之交臂,担心不合格可以找体检知音帮忙处理一下,关于s->c语言、以及sC语言输出数组的知识点,小编会在本文中详细的给大家介绍到,也希望能够帮助到大家的

本文目录一览:

c语言中s.data和s-data如何区别?

一个_sidata 的注释你理解错了,注释的意思是 这是.data段的初始化值的起始地址,这个地址应该是属于代码段的地址。

s->c语言(sC语言输出数组)
(图片来源网络,侵删)

C语言 *s 和s[] 的区别 *s在定义的时候是定义一个指标变数,使用的时候是取出指标变数s所指向的单元的值,s[] 就是一个数组。

形式和意义不同。形式不同。data指的是单数形式,而datas是复数形式。意思不同。data的意思是一个指南针,而datas指的是多个指南针。

s->c语言(sC语言输出数组)
(图片来源网络,侵删)

二者完全可以互换,意义相同,唯一的区别是*s中s是一个变量,又叫指针变量;s[]中的s也是指针,但是,是一个常量,就是指针常量。简单说,就是一个值可以变,一个值固定。

s和r都是节点的指针 这是最简单的链表节点 一个节点由两部分组成 char data 和 node *next next也是指针 这个算法是默认有一个初始头节点的,由r指向。因为只有一个节点 所以自己也是尾节点,r指向它没毛病。

s->c语言(sC语言输出数组)
(图片来源网络,侵删)

LinkList &L表示L的一个引用,引用作为形参,参数就不是“值传递”了,如在函数中改变形参的值,则被引用的变量值也相应改变。

c语言中s-data=e是什么意思啊,有谁能形象说明,还有next

s和r都是节点的指针 这是最简单的链表节点 一个节点由两部分组成 char data 和 node *next next也是指针 这个算法是默认有一个初始头节点的,由r指向。因为只有一个节点 所以自己也是尾节点,r指向它没毛病。

E表示用科学技术法,做为一个字符串或者是定义的宏。当变量E==0时候,此时把E当作表达式来看,表达式E的值为***,形如if(E)这样的语句不被执行。

第一个参数P是指针,代表还有链接链表的指针。 (因为每个表项后面都有一个指针,所以用指针来判断是否到达最后一个位置) 第二个参数是计数器,找到第i个位置。

这是单片机C语言***有的关键字,表示数据存储区,标准C语言中是没有的,如 int data x ;表示将 x 定义在数据存储区。单片机的C语言***用C51编译器。

LinkList &L表示L的一个引用,引用作为形参,参数就不是“值传递”了,如在函数中改变形参的值,则被引用的变量值也相应改变。

申请动态储存空间 allocate space for s***ing 链表下一节点指向空 the next node of the list point to NULL 大概就是这样了,作业嘛,就不给你翻译太好(其实也是翻译不好),免得老师以为你是抄的。

C语言数据结构:s-top=0和s-top==0有什么区别?

1、c语言中-top是t=(s-top==0) s 是结构体的指针,指向top域,如果是==0,则t是TRUE。在计算机领域,堆栈是一个不容忽视的概念,堆栈是两种数据结构。

2、从数据结构的角度上来讲其实没有实质的区别,只是具体实现方式的不同(习惯不同、约定不同)。数据结构更侧重理论,top=-1和top=0的区别更侧重实现上的不同。栈空top=0:这种栈指针指向的是有效值。

3、= 是程序代码里的不等于的意思。从你这个来看,我觉得S是指向一个结构体的指针,top是该结构体里的一个元素。所以就是S指向的那个结构体实例里的top这个元素不等于0的意思。是if里的判决条件吧。

4、在一般的计算机系统中,基本的运算和操作有以下4类:算术运算、逻辑运算、关系运算和数据传输。 (2)算法的控制结构:算法中各操作之间的执行顺序称为算法的控制结构。 描述算法的工具通常有传统流程图、N-S结构化流程图、算法描述语言等。

5、(--(s.top))s是stack s.top有两种可能 一是指向栈顶元素的指针 二是指向比栈顶元素更高一层的空元素 从这里的实际情况来看,我判断是第二种情况,当s.top==0时,栈为空。

c语言中-是什么意思?如;s-i[0]=0x39;这句话是什么意思?

x39代表16进制。我拿TC0来讲为什么是B。i[0]的字节数据:低字节是00111001,高字节是00000000,合起来就是0x39。而s-c[0]取得是低字节的的数据。00111001对应的十六进制就是0x39(ascii码),其对应字符就是9。

这是联合体,共用一段内存,int是占2个字节,long占4个字节,char占1个字节。

C语言中,算术运算符“%”代表模(取余)运算,“++”代表变量自增运算,“--”代表变量自减运算。模运算“%”“模”是“Mod”的音译,模运算多应用于程序编写中。 Mod的含义为求余。

由于s所指向的是联合储存结构,所以他是一块8字节的内存块。

这意味着这道题目是有很严重的问题的,因为它并没有说明机器是大端序还是小端序,而给出的答案只在小端序下才成立。

不好意思,开始的时候看花眼了 15该提输出值不确定,因为C++中规定,新声明的变量如果没有付初值则该变量的默认值将随机出现。

在c语言中S-elem[S-top]=x啥意思?

S-elem[--s-top]不是一个地址,S-elem才是一个地址。

一个是数组,用于保存数据,一个是整型变量,用于标记数组内有效数据个数。下面三个函数都是简单的对结构体成员的数***算。s.data[s.top]=x;就是将x这个变量的值保存到s结构体的数组成员内。

c语言中-top是t=(s-top==0) s 是结构体的指针,指向top域,如果是==0,则t是TRUE。在计算机领域,堆栈是一个不容忽视的概念,堆栈是两种数据结构。

c语言中,!x是一个逻辑运算符,r.rp!是一个寄存器指针,用于指向寄存器中的值。c语言介绍如下:C语言是一门面向过程的、抽象化的通用程序设计语言,广泛应用于底层开发。C语言能以简易的方式编译、处理低级存储器。

C语言链表中s-next=p;s=p什么意思

1、s-next=p的含义是将p链接到s结点的后面,使p结点成为s结点的下一个相邻结点。

2、r-next=p;——让指针r指向的结点的下一个结点的指针等于指针p。r=p;——将p赋给r。虽然看不到上下文,但大致意思是执行这两后,就将p指向的链表接在了r指向的结点后,并r的指向向后移动了一个结点……供参考。

3、s是首址,指向你刚刚开辟的新结点(你要在链表中插入,肯定得先开辟一个新结点,链表插入删除之类操作处理的单位就是结点。

4、s-next 或者 *s.next 题中s-next 为s节点的下一个节点的地址; p-next为p的下一个节点的指针。题的操作室将s节点插入p节点之后。如果还是不理解,看一下C指针和链表相关知识即可。

5、pNext=(struct Node *)malloc(sizeof(struct Node));这时候应该将头结点head的next域指向该新的结点。但是head一般不移动,因为移动后就找不到头结点了。

以上就是关于s->c语言和sC语言输出数组的简单介绍,还有要补充的,大家一定要关注我们,欢迎有问题咨询体检知音。